The OEM ZR1 airbox, derived from the LT6 Z06 design, retains several inherent limitations. Its restricted shape and limited internal volume are dictated by the packaging constraints behind the factory trunk panel. When paired with the higher-output LT7 engine, these restrictions become even more pronounced. Our solution eliminates these bottlenecks through an organically shaped, high-volume intake system combined with our patented Venturi housing design. This configuration optimizes airflow efficiency and reduces restriction throughout the intake path.

PATENTED FILTER HOUSING

The ZR1 Filter Housing features two of our patented Venturi pods, designed to merge into a large-volume intake chamber while integrating dual MAF tubes that precisely direct airflow to each turbocharger.

 

This system is the next evolution of our C8 Z06 housing, developed through months of intensive prototyping, testing, and data-driven refinement.

 

Inside the carbon fibre housing are two bespoke high-flow filters paired with aluminium cowls that help guide airflow directly onto the filtration surfaces. The housing surrounds the reverse-mounted filters and smoothly transitions airflow toward the MAF tubes.

 

As the cross-sectional area gradually reduces, the design creates a Venturi effect, accelerating airflow while maintaining laminar flow conditions—much like a large velocity stack. The result is highly efficient airflow delivery and improved turbocharger response.

DYNO TESTING

Our C8 Z06 Intake was developed in conjunction with Corvette specialists, Paragon Performance who carried out performance testing and data logging for each prototype that we produced. All dyno tests were carried out in an independent facility and you can find a video link in the relevant tab showing how that was done. All other variables were minimised for a reliable and repeatable result. A fully stock ZR1 was tested with engine temperatures at a stabilized value and then the car was left on the dyno while the intake was installed. After installation the car was allowed to reach the same temperatures and then run on the dyno several times for a consistent result. In fact the dyno runs with the Eventuri intake were done with higher ambient temperatures.

 

As can be seen, there is a significant gain throughout the RPM range, and in particular in the mid-range around 5300rpm where the intake released gains of up to 110whp and 108ft-lb of torque. This is unchartered territory for an intake and just shows how restrictive the stock system is. CFD ANALYSIS

CFD flow analysis was conducted on the intake to optimise the shape for smooth flow and therefore reduced drag. The simulation below shows a sweeping cut plot of velocities through the intake. The streamlines demonstrate how the intake takes turbulent flow upstream of the filters and shapes the flow to be smooth and linear as it collects and moves through the MAF tube sections to the throttle body. The velocity increases as it moves through the MAF tube yet remains laminar and uniform throughout the tube to the engine. This analysis is showing the results for one of the prototypes, which was then improved for the final version.
